Permanence

usgb/ˈpɜːrmənəns/
noun

The quality of lasting forever or for a very long time.

The permanence of the statue in the park was ensured by its sturdy materials.

Time Aspect

Use 'permanence' when discussing things that are unchanging or lasting, opposing temporary or fleeting situations.

Despite the evolving fashion trends, the permanence of classic styles is undeniable.

Emotional Weight

'Permanence' often carries a strong emotional implication, especially when discussing relationships or values.

They celebrated the permanence of their friendship on its tenth anniversary.

Metaphorical Use

In addition to physical longevity, 'permanence' can be used metaphorically to express enduring ideas or qualities.

The novel's exploration of human nature added to its permanence in the literature canon.
